Current Activities :

QEM is also engaged in mineral processing activities of massionary stone. Currently we are processing stone boulders to produce 5-10 & 10-22 mm aggregates and manufactured sand (0-5 mm) from its two - stage SANDVIK crushing plant in Khetri tehsil's Ramkumarpura village in Rajasthan with a designed capacity of 1.2 Million MT per year. Proposed Activities :

QEM is aiming to achieve a processing capacity of 5 million metric tons by next year end. We also plan to introduce processing facilities for other minerals like Slica (SiO2) and silica sand other than massionary stone, which we are processing right now. We have already planned another three-stage crushing & screening solution from SANDVIK for our clients, with a designed capacity of 1.4 Million MT to process stone boulders upto 1000 mm feed size from our in house massionary mineral mines at Toda, Neemkathana. The site has location advantage of being in the vicinity of famous PATAN ZONE and has a national highway connectivity to DELHI and JAIPUR. The project will be operational in the current financial year itself.
